- The distance between Cape Hooper, Nt, Canada and Labe, Guinea is approximately 7,445 km or 4,627 mi.
- To reach Cape Hooper, Nt in this distance one would set out from Labe bearing 341.1°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Cape Hooper, Nt bearing 299.8° or WNW .
- Cape Hooper, Nt has a tundra climate (ET) whereas Labe has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Cape Hooper, Nt is in or near the polar desert biome whereas Labe is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 33.5 °C (60.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 22.8 °C (41°F) more in Cape Hooper, Nt.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1266 mm (49.8 in) less which is equivalent to 1266 l/m² (31.07 US gal/ft²) or 12,660,000 l/ha (1,353,438 US gal/ac) less. About 1/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 51.6° lower in Cape Hooper, Nt than in Labe.
